Understanding Surface Dressing in Road Maintenance

Surface dressing is a vital technique in road maintenance. It involves applying a new layer of material to the surface of existing roads. This process enhances durability and extends the road's lifespan, often by up to 10 years, according to recent industry studies. The method is cost-effective and quick. However, proper execution is essential.

The effectiveness of surface dressing hinges on several factors. Moisture levels play a crucial role; roads must be properly dried before application. A 2019 report highlighted that 30% of surface dressing failures stemmed from inadequate preparation. Equipment calibration also matters. Incorrectly proportioned mixtures lead to inferior outcomes.

While surface dressing can rejuvenate aging roads, it is not foolproof. Surface texture and traffic conditions affect longevity. A recent analysis showed that roads subjected to heavy traffic may experience quicker degradation, necessitating more frequent treatments. Continuous assessment after application can help identify areas needing further attention. Adjustments based on feedback can drive improvements in road maintenance practices.

Post-Application Care and Maintenance of Surfaced Roads

After applying surface dressing on roads, proper care ensures longevity. Regular inspections help identify early signs of wear. Look for loose stones or cracks. These issues can lead to bigger problems if ignored.

Tips for post-application care include sealing any visible cracks. This prevents water infiltration. Water can erode the structure beneath. Another suggestion is to limit heavy traffic for at least a week. This allows the surface to cure properly.

Routine maintenance is key to a successful surface. Keep the area clear of debris. However, not all roads will wear evenly. Some might need touch-ups sooner than others. Adapt your maintenance routine based on observed conditions. Keeping a close eye can save costs in the long run.

Aspect Details
Preparation Clean the road surface and ensure it is free from dust and debris.
Materials Required Bitumen emulsion, aggregate (stones), and water for mixing.
Application Method Apply a thin layer of bitumen followed by a spread of aggregate, compacting it onto the surface.
Post-Application Care Keep the area free from traffic for at least 24 hours for proper curing.
Maintenance Tips Regular inspections and timely repairs of cracks and potholes to enhance lifespan.
Expected Lifespan Typically 5-10 years depending on traffic volume and climate factors.

Common Challenges and Solutions in Surface Dressing Projects

Surface dressing is a popular method for road repairs, yet it comes with its own set of challenges. One notable issue is the application timing. The temperature and weather conditions significantly influence the bonding process. For example, applying surface dressing in wet weather can lead to poor adhesion. Industry reports indicate that up to 30% of surface dressing projects face adhesion failures due to inadequate weather considerations.

Another challenge is the choice of materials. Different aggregates can drastically affect the lifespan of repairs. Reports suggest that using high-quality aggregates can improve the durability of the road by up to 50%. However, the cost is often a factor, leading some projects to use lower-grade materials. This decision can result in frequent repairs, ultimately increasing long-term costs and disruptions.

Finally, the skill of the crew plays a crucial role. Inadequate training can lead to improper application techniques. Statistics show that poorly executed surface dressing can reduce effectiveness by 40%. Regular training and certification can solve these issues, ensuring that crews are well-equipped to handle the complexities of each project. Implementing these solutions is essential for achieving lasting road repairs.
